Disable Wireless LAN Interface: Check the box to disable the Wireless LAN Interface, by so doing, you won't be able to make wireless connection with this Access Point in the network you are located. In other words, this device will not be visible by any wireless station. 2. 4GHz (B+G): 802. 11b supported rate and 802. 11g supported rate. The default is 2. 4GHz (B+G) mode. SSID (Network ID): Provide SSID for wireless client survey and connection. The SSID differentiates one WLAN from another; therefore, all access points and all devices attempting to connect to a specific WLAN must use the same SSID. A device will not be permitted to join the BSS unless it can provide the unique SSID. An SSID is also referred to as a network name because essentially it is a name that identifies a wireless network. This field is to provide for wireless client connection. 37 Channel Number: Allow user to set the channel manually or automatically. If "Auto" is selected, user can set the channel range to have Wireless Access Point automatically survey and choose the channel with best situation for communication. The number of channels supported depends on the region of this Access Point. All stations communicating with the Access Point must use the same channel. SSID of Extended Interface: This field is the SSID of remote Access Point to connect to. 802. 1d Spanning Tree: Spanning tree is to prevent bridge loop when there are multiple active paths between network nodes. Spanning tree allows a network design to include spare (redundant) links to provide automatic backup paths if an active link fails, without the danger of bridge loops, or the need for manual enabling/disabling of these backup links. Site Survey: Use this button to find out the remote Access Point and check the signal strength. [. . . ] Or click Upload to start the upgrade. 74 4. 3 Save / Reload Settings This function enables users to save the current configurations as a file (i. e. config. dat) To load configuration from a file, enter the file name or click Browse. . . Save Settings to File: Click "SAVE" to save the current configuration to file. When prompted the upper left screen, select "Save this file to disk", and the upper right screen will prompt you a dialog box to enter the file name and the file location. if you want to load a pre-saved file, enter the file name with the correct path and then click on Upload.
